Flying Yankee - B&M 6000 - brakeman's side doorA look in through the open door to the brakeman's area of the cab. You can really appreciate the technology of 1935 from this view. To the left of the brake wheel is a post that will soon hold the seat. At the time of this picture, the "A" unit of the 6000 was inside the Claremont Concord RR shops getting a rebuilt Winton engine.
